Coleman CT200U Specifications
The standard CT200U specifications commonly published in the owner’s manual include a 196cc air-cooled four-stroke engine, 20 MPH top speed, 19-inch tires, 42-inch wheelbase and 200-pound maximum rider/load capacity.(Coleman Mini Bike CT200U)
| Feature | Coleman CT200U |
|---|---|
| Engine | 196cc 4-Stroke OHV |
| Cylinder | Single Cylinder |
| Cooling | Air-Cooled |
| Starting | Recoil / Pull Start |
| Rated Power | 3.8 kW @ 3,600 RPM |
| Rated Torque | 11 Nm @ 2,500 RPM |
| Factory Top Speed | Approximately 20 MPH |
| Transmission | Centrifugal Clutch |
| Drive | Chain Drive |
| Gear Ratio | 10:1 |
| Front Tire | AT19 x 7-8 |
| Rear Tire | AT19 x 7-8 |
| Brake | Rear Drum |
| Wheelbase | 42 inches |
| Ground Clearance | 6.5 inches |
| Vehicle Weight | Approximately 121 lbs |
| Weight Capacity | 200 lbs |
| Fuel Tank | 0.95 gallon |
| Frame | Steel |
| Oil Capacity | 0.63 qt / 0.6 L |
Specifications can vary by model year and CT200U variant, so buyers should verify the specifications of their particular bike before ordering replacement parts.(Coleman Mini Bike CT200U)
196cc Coleman CT200U Engine
The heart of the Coleman CT200U is its 196cc OHV four-stroke engine.
This type of engine is popular in the mini-bike community because it provides useful low-end torque while remaining relatively simple to maintain. The factory specification lists approximately 3.8 kW at 3,600 RPM and 11 Nm of rated torque at 2,500 RPM.
The pull-start system also keeps the bike mechanically straightforward.

How Fast Is the Coleman CT200U?
The stock Coleman CT200U top speed is approximately 20 MPH according to the standard owner’s manual specification.(Coleman Mini Bike CT200U)
The factory setup is designed around controlled recreational riding rather than high-speed performance.
Actual speed can vary according to:
- Rider weight
- Terrain
- Tire pressure
- Engine condition
- Chain condition
- Gear ratio
- Temperature
- Elevation
- Mechanical setup

Coleman CT200U Automatic Clutch
One reason the CT200U is approachable for beginners is its centrifugal clutch.
There is no conventional manual transmission requiring the rider to operate a clutch lever and shift through gears.
The basic riding process is simple:
Start โ accelerate โ slow down โ stop.
The centrifugal clutch engages as engine RPM increases and transfers power through the chain-drive system.
The standard specification lists a 10:1 gear ratio and chain drive.
For maintenance, owners should regularly inspect the chain, sprockets, clutch area and chain alignment.

Coleman CT200U Maintenance Guide
Regular maintenance is essential for keeping a small gas-powered engine running reliably.
1. Check engine oil
The manual lists approximately 0.63 qt / 0.6 L oil capacity and SAE 10W-30 oil. Always follow the owner’s manual for your specific model and operating conditions.
2. Inspect the air filter
A dirty air filter can restrict airflow and affect engine performance.
3. Check the spark plug
Inspect the plug periodically and replace it when necessary.
4. Maintain the chain
Keep the chain properly adjusted, lubricated and aligned.
5. Inspect the tires
Check tire pressure, tread and sidewalls before riding.
6. Inspect the brakes
Make sure the brake provides firm and predictable stopping action.
7. Keep the fuel system clean
Use appropriate fresh fuel and avoid leaving old gasoline sitting in the system for extended periods.

CT200U vs. CT200U-EX
The CT200U family includes different variants, so it’s important not to assume every Coleman mini bike has identical equipment.
For example, the CT200U-EX manual lists different suspension equipment from the standard CT200U while retaining the 196cc engine platform and 20 MPH published top speed.
Always identify your exact model before ordering replacement components.
This is especially important for:
- Brake components
- Forks
- Wheels
- Engine mounts
- Electrical components
- Body panels
- Suspension parts

Coleman CT200U FAQs
How fast does a Coleman CT200U go?
The standard CT200U has a published factory top speed of approximately 20 MPH.
How many cc is the Coleman CT200U?
The CT200U uses a 196cc four-stroke OHV single-cylinder engine.
Is the Coleman CT200U automatic?
Yes. The standard CT200U uses a centrifugal clutch with automatic operation, so the rider does not manually shift gears.
What size tires does a CT200U use?
The standard specification lists AT19 x 7-8 tires on the front and rear.
How much weight can a Coleman CT200U carry?
The published maximum weight capacity is 200 pounds.
How much does a CT200U weigh?
The standard owner’s manual lists vehicle weight at approximately 121 pounds.
Does the Coleman CT200U have suspension?
The standard CT200U specification lists low-pressure tires as its suspension system, while some CT200U variants use different front suspension arrangements. Verify the exact model before purchasing parts.
What fuel does the CT200U use?
The CT200U is a gasoline-powered four-stroke mini bike. The owner’s manual specifies unleaded gasoline, with the exact minimum octane recommendation depending on the model/version.
